Compute and hardware:
- Azure Cobalt 200 VMs
Arm-based VMs, 50% better performance for AI workloads. - Confidential Live Migration for Intel TDX confidential VMs
Private preview enables protected host migration with minimal interruption. - Guest RDMA for Azure Boost
100 Gb/s low-latency Guest RDMA for distributed AI and HPC. - Lasv5 and Laosv5 VMs
Upgrades include: 35% more CPU, 138 TB local storage, and 200 Gbps Bandwidth - Azure Linux 4.0
Azure Linux 4.0 extends container hosting to general-purpose VMs. - Surface RTX Spark Dev Box and DGX Station for Windows
RTX Spark: 1 petaflop, 128 GB memory. DGX Station: 1T parameters locally. - Project Solara
Standardizes building, deploying, managing agent-first devices end-to-end. - Majorana 2 (Microsoft Quantum)
Redesigned materials stack aims for more reliable topological qubits.

Azure Local, Arc, and edge:
- Small form factor infrastructure
Azure-managed edge infrastructure runs AI and ops closer to devices. - Foundry Local on Azure Local for sovereign AI
Multi-node sovereign AI with local retrieval for regulated orgs. - Foundry Local multi-node inference and vLLM
Multi-node vLLM scales on-prem serving to production. - GitHub Enterprise Local
GitHub Enterprise Local keeps DevSecOps workflows air-gapped. - Agentic retrieval in Foundry Local
On-prem agentic M365 retrieval reduces latency and exposure risk.

Cosmos DB and DocumentDB:
- Cosmos DB Build 2026 roundup
Major capabilities ease AI-native workloads. - Cosmos DB Agent Kit
Agent Kit improves app quality. - Cosmos DB backup
Vaulted backups improve data loss protection. - Cosmos DB all versions and deletes change feed
Change feed enables audit and replay. - Cosmos DB change partition keys
Online partition changes enable repartitioning. - Cosmos DB Migration Assistant
AI-guided workflows lower modernization complexity. - Cosmos DB integrated embeddings
Integrated embeddings reduce pipeline overhead. - OmniVec
Open-source embedding pipeline standardizes vectorization. - DocumentDB MCP Toolkit
MCP Toolkit enables safer agent automation. - DocumentDB instant free tier clusters
Instant free-tier provisioning speeds evaluation. - DocumentDB migration extension
Migration extension reduces setup complexity. - Advanced full-text search in Azure DocumentDB
Fuzzy, proximity, and BM25 search improve hybrid text and vector retrieval. - DocumentDB service-managed failovers
Service-managed failovers automate regional recovery. - DocumentDB graceful failovers
Graceful failovers enable planned transitions. - DocumentDB change streams
Richer change streams enable event sourcing.
